Quaker Steak ‘N Lube Buckeye BBQ Wings

Quaker Steak ‘N Lube has some crazy good wing sauces. From the mild to the insane, from traditional Buffalo to Asian sesame, they have you covered no matter your heat or taste preferences. Quaker Steak ‘N Lube Buckeye BBQ wing sauce is a bit on the spicy side. But it’s also a bit sweet. Nice and smooth, it’s the perfect sauce not only for wings, but also for anything you slather with BBQ sauce. Like grilled chicken, burgers, or ribs. Or drizzle it on some pulled pork or sliced brisket. It’s a great all-around BBQ sauce, despite having ‘wing’ in its name.

Quaker Steak 'N Lube Buckeye BBQ Wings

What’s In A Name?

So why the name? Does Quaker Steak ‘N Lube Buckeye BBQ wing sauce contain buckeyes, the chestnut-looking nut often associated with Ohio? Well, I don’t think so, but it was named the preferred sauce of Ohio State. And Quaker Steak ‘N Lube was founded in Ohio. So, I’m guessing that explains the name! No matter what, it’s a great sauce.

Private Selection Gochujang Honey Garlic Wings

Yowsa, this right here is a fantastic bottled wing sauce! On a whim I picked up a bottle each of the Private Selection wing sauces during a trip to Kroger. The first one I tried was the Gochujang Honey Garlic wing sauce. I was so seriously blown away I could not wait until I made my next batch of wings and tossed them in more sauce. Private Selection Gochujang Honey Garlic wings are a winner!

Private Selection Gochujang Honey Garlic Wings

Packed With Flavors

Garlicky, spicy, sweet and with a slightly fermented chile paste flavor, wings (or for that matter, anything) covered in this sauce will be absolutely delicious.

This sauce has me excited, looking forward to the remaining sauces in my Private Selection collection. The price was right (around $3 a bottle) and the taste? Amazing. You cannot lose with Private Selection Gochujang wing sauce.

Plucker’s Sesame Wings

The fine folks at Plucker’s have done it to me again. They went and made yet another dream-worthy wing sauce that I just cannot get enough of: Plucker’s Sesame wing sauce. This time it’s an Asian-inspired sauce with a hint of teriyaki and sesame oil. Neither flavor is overwhelming, but balanced perfectly. Sesame oil can definitely be too strong for me, but this sauce nailed it perfectly. This is one of the best wing sauces I’ve had. There’s no way I can tell you how good this sauce is without crying tears of happiness. Just the memory of these wings makes my day.

Plucker's Sesame Wings

Asian-Inspired Deliciousness

Plucker’s Sesame wing sauce is just the right thickness, too. No pools of sauce at the bottom of the plate here. Come to think of it, no sauce on my fingers either. Ok, that’s because I licked them.

This would also make for a fantastic dipping sauce for nuggets. Or slather it on a grilled or smoked rack of ribs for a fantastic Asian-inspired dinner.
